Reliquary and statue of Saint Hermes, saint patron of the town of Ronse Church of St-Nicolas, reliquary, Tournai plate, 18th century, wooden statue, 17th century.
St Hermes was a roman soldier, martyr in the 2nd century. He is the patron of the town of Ronse where his relics are kept in the basilic bearing his name. The martyr is worshiped in Tournai at St-Nicolas church since the 15th century.
